Deer Talk Now Podcast is a comprehensive audio and video podcast where the white-tailed deer is the star of the show. Expert guests join the virtual deer camp each week to discuss everything from deer behavior, biology and scientific research to herd and land management, hunting ethics, newsworthy events, and hunting tips, tactics and strategies.

If you've heard of the Johnny King Buck, you know that he was denied the No. 1 world-record typical title due to a Boone & Crockett scorer deeming the right G-3 as an abnormal point, despite numerous other scorers agreeing the rack was a 6x6 typical grossing more than 215 inches.
